D.E.H.® 20

D.E.H.® 20 Epoxy Curing Agent is an economical, liquid diethylenetriamine (DETA) aliphatic polyamine hardener that provides a short pot-life and cures in minutes with standard unmodified liquid epoxy resins. D.E.H.® 20 Epoxy Curing Agent is used for civil engineering applications, maintenance paints, and in the manufacture of epoxy-amine adducts. It is also used in adhesives, epoxy composite applications and as an accelerator for polyamide curing agents. In electrical applications, D.E.H.® 20 Epoxy Curing Agent is used for casting, potting and encapsulation.
